[LiveSky] Almost all my Sessions suddenly show zero Observations, but the Observations exist and are tied to sessions

I have 147 sessions, all with observations. Suddenly, only 5 sessions show non-zero counts, the rest show zero counts. Four of the five sessions with non-zero counts have the correct count, the fifth count is incorrect (too low). All of the observations are listed in Observations and are tied to the correct sessions.

SkySafari 7.6.5.3 shows all sessions with correct observation counts. I am reluctant to sync with LiveSky until this gets resolved.
